Books & Art

  1. 2 Danks Street

    2 Danks Street

    A collection of art galleries, jewellery studio and award winning cafe.

    Home to eight of Sydney's best contemporary art galleries, a fine arts dealer, a working jewellery studio and an award winning café. Changing monthly exhibitions of the latest contemporary art from leading Australian and international artists ensure a stimulating experience. Venues include Aboriginal and Pacific Art, Annette Larkin Fine Art, Brenda May Gallery, Dominik Mersch Gallery, Stella Downer Fine Art, Studio 20/17, Syndicate, The Depot Gallery, Depot II Gallery, Utopia Art Sydney and Wilson Street Gallery.

  18. Brett Whiteley Studio

    Brett Whiteley Studio

    Former workplace & home of artist

    Delve into the former studio, home and exhibition space of one of Australia's most famous and important artists - Brett Whiteley. Glimpse into his private collection of inspiring sketchbooks, photographs and personal memorabilia (weekends only).

  47. The Ken Done Gallery

    The Ken Done Gallery

    The bright collectables of Australian favourite Ken Done are housed in the beautiful heritage Australian Steam Navigation Building. Done is known for his eyeful synthesis of native motifs and local foreshore icons like the Sydney Harbour Bridge in his original works, limited editions and clothing designs.
